What is wd-sys.exe?

wd-sys.exe is the Windows service component of WD System utilities that coordinates WD drive health monitoring, driver loading, and firmware update checks for Western Digital hardware. It runs in the background to ensure WD devices stay healthy and accessible.

wd-sys operates as a set of background processes: a service, loader, and helper utilities that interface with WD drivers, collect SMART data, and communicate with WD servers for status, diagnostics, and updates.

Quick Fact: WD System Service is designed to run quietly in the background, provisioning drive health telemetry and driver support without frequent user interaction.

How to Tell if wd-sys.exe is Legitimate or Malware

  1. File Location: Must be in C:\Program Files\WD System\wd-sys.exe or C:\Program Files (x86)\WD System\wd-sys.exe. Any other location is suspicious.
  2. Digital Signature: Right-click wd-sys.exe in Explorer → Properties → Digital Signatures. Should show a certificate issued to "WD, Inc." or a WD entity.
  3. Resource Usage: Normal usage is 1-15% CPU and 50-300 MB memory. Constant high usage when WD software is not active is suspicious.
  4. Behavior: WD System Service should run as a background service and not spawn unexpected network activity when WD software isn't used.

Red Flags: If wd-sys.exe is located outside WD folders, lacks a valid signature, or triggers high activity when WD software isn't running, scan with updated antivirus. Beware of similarly-named files like "wd-sys.exe" from untrusted sources.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is wd-sys.exe a virus?

No, the legitimate wd-sys.exe from WD is not a virus. Verify the path (C:\Program Files\WD System\wd-sys.exe or C:\Program Files (x86)\WD System\wd-sys.exe) and ensure a valid WD signature.

Why is wd-sys.exe using CPU?

wd-sys.exe may use CPU during drive health checks, firmware update checks, or when WD software is performing maintenance tasks. If usage stays elevated, check WD settings and connected drives.

Can I delete wd-sys.exe?

You can uninstall WD software to remove wd-sys.exe, but this may disable drive health monitoring and WD features. Reinstall WD software if you need WD drive support again.

Can I disable wd-sys.exe at startup?

Yes, disable WD System Service in Task Manager's Startup tab or in Services.msc. This will stop automatic WD monitoring until you re-enable it.

Why are there multiple WD processes running?

WD uses multiple components (service, loader, updater) to manage hardware, drivers, and updates. This modular approach enhances reliability but can appear as several processes.

How do I verify wd-sys.exe is legitimate?

Confirm path in C:\Program Files\WD System or C:\Program Files (x86)\WD System, check the Digital Signature for WD Inc., and ensure CPU/memory usage aligns with drive activity.
